Which one is larger 2 tonnes or 3000 kg?

Convert to the same units then a comparison can be made: 1 tonne = 1000 kg → 2 tonne = 2 × 1000 kg = 2000 kg 2000 < 3000 → 2000 kg < 3000 kg → 2 tonnes < 3000 kg 3000 kg is larger than 2 tonnes.

300 grams is what fraction of 1 kg?

To find the fraction of 300 grams in 1 kg, you need to convert both units to the same measurement. Since 1 kg is equal to 1000 grams, you can express 300 grams as a fraction of 1000 grams. Therefore, 300 grams is 300/1000 or 3/10 of 1 kg.
